Students need to be comfortable when reading, offering them cushions to sit around the room with will allow for students to have the ability to choose where and how they are sitting. Additionally, having a classroom set of dictionaries will allow for students to utilize dictionaries for assessments, projects, reading, comprehension, and teaching writing conventions. Students will utilize these resources daily and for years to come to help grow their knowledge base and teach them to be lifelong learners. Students in the community have not had much experience with flexible seating previously. By allowing them to enjoy the process of reading through the choice of books, seating, and location within the room, my goal is to encourage these practices at home. Finally, my students are able to utilize a dictionary on their state standardized tests, knowing when and how to use a dictionary is KEY to their success. Currently, students have dictionaries and thesauruses combined, but these are not allowed on standardized tests and are outdated resources with a severe lack of age-appropriate language conventions that students in 4th grade need for appropriate rigor in their studies. Having Merriam Webster dictionaries available will allow students to have access to more current language use within their learning environment.
